At work, I use these to write on oil change stickers on a daily basis. They work fine for a while before becoming stuck in the open position and staining my shirt pocket with ink. It will make a clicking sound, but it will not shut. It may take several clicks to retract it again, at which point you should discard it. br>Fortunately, I wear dark blue shirts, so the stain isn't as noticeable, but it's noticeable on my white t-shirt. I have a few shirts that I use as a base layer. br>When I use them, I simply click them on and put them back in my pocket, but I always notice that they are stuck on when it is too late. I keep using them because the click function is easier than pulling a cap and reinstalling it after each use on a non retractable type of marker with two hands or my teeth.
